If the framing contains a lot of pieces which are near each other and have the same label, you can limit the number of labels displayed in the drawing. Labels are added for all pieces, but when the maximum number of labels is reached, any further labels are added on a hidden layer. You can set the maximum number of labels by adding the following keyword in the BDSXX keyword group:
pce_schedule_hide_labels= MAXNUMBER,LEVEL,SHOWMESS
where
MAXNUMBER = Defines the maximum number of labels displayed in
the drawing (per identical label), the rest of the labels are
hidden.
LEVEL = Defines the layer to which the hidden labels are moved.
SHOWMESS = Defines whether the user is warned about the hidden
labels. May have the value 0 (no warning given) or 1 (warning
given).
Example:
pce_schedule_hide_labels= 20,101,1
If necessary, you can add a common label for pieces in a certain area e.g. using the text adding function.
